Exploring Spark Plug Manufacturers The Heart of Internal Combustion Engines


Spark plugs are an essential component in the operation of internal combustion engines, playing a crucial role in igniting the air-fuel mixture within the combustion chamber. This process is vital for the efficient functioning of both gasoline and natural gas-powered engines. As a key part of automotive technology, the selection of high-quality spark plugs is influenced by various factors including performance, durability, and cost-effectiveness. Therefore, understanding the landscape of spark plug manufacturers is essential for automotive enthusiasts, mechanics, and vehicle manufacturers alike.


The Importance of Spark Plug Manufacturers


The automotive industry relies heavily on spark plug manufacturers to produce reliable, high-performance products. These manufacturers vary in size, range, and specialization, producing spark plugs for different applications including passenger vehicles, motorcycles, and racing cars. The quality of a spark plug directly affects engine performance, fuel efficiency, and emissions, making the integrity of the manufacturer all the more critical.


Major Spark Plug Manufacturers


Several prominent manufacturers dominate the spark plug market, each offering a unique blend of innovation, technology, and experience. Some of the most recognized names in the industry include


1. NGK Spark Plug Co., Ltd. Founded in 1936, NGK is one of the world's leading manufacturers of spark plugs and related components. With a reputation for high quality and performance, NGK spark plugs are used in various vehicles, from everyday cars to high-performance racing machines. Their advanced manufacturing processes and extensive research and development programs ensure that they remain at the forefront of spark plug technology.


2. Denso Corporation A long-standing player in the automotive industry, Denso has been producing spark plugs since 1959. Known for their innovative designs, Denso spark plugs are engineered for durability and efficiency. They also invest heavily in technology, utilizing iridium and platinum to enhance performance and longevity, which is especially appreciated in high-demand automotive applications.

3. Bosch Bosch is another giant in the automotive sector, renowned for its engineering prowess and dedication to quality. The company produces a wide range of spark plugs suited for various engine types, including both standard and high-performance variants. Bosch spark plugs are often recognized for their reliability and superior ignition performance, making them a popular choice among both manufacturers and consumers.


4. Champion With a rich history dating back to 1907, Champion has built a solid reputation in the spark plug market, particularly in the realm of motorsports and outdoor equipment. Their spark plugs are designed to meet rigorous performance standards, catering to both everyday driving and high-performance racing scenarios.


Innovations Driving the Industry


The spark plug industry is evolving, with manufacturers continually seeking ways to enhance spark plug design and functionality. Innovations such as laser-welded electrodes, advanced ceramic insulators, and improved materials are paving the way for higher efficiency and longer life spans. Additionally, manufacturers are increasingly focusing on aftermarket products, allowing car owners to enhance their vehicle's performance with specialized spark plugs.


Moreover, the growing trend of electrification in the automotive industry poses challenges and opportunities for spark plug manufacturers. As hybrid and electric vehicles become more prevalent, the need for traditional spark plugs may diminish, pushing manufacturers to diversify their product lines and explore new areas of technology.
